#fe659b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#fe659b is composed of 99.6% red, 39.6% green and 60.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 60.2% magenta, 39%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 338.8 degrees, a saturation of 98.7% and a lightness of 69.6%. #fe659b color hex could be obtained by blending #ffcaff with #fd0037. Closest websafe color is: #ff6699.

#fe659b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#fe659b has RGB values of R:254, G:101, B:155 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.6, Y:0.39, K:0. Its decimal value is 16672155.

Shades and Tints of #fe659b
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020001 is the darkest color, while #ffedf4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#fe659b
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b6adb0 is the less saturated color, while #fe659b is the most saturated one.
